Frequently Asked Questions

EH55 and EH40 refer to the Efficiency House standards in Germany. EH55 means the building uses only 55% of the primary energy of a reference building, while EH40 uses only 40%. Lower numbers indicate higher energy efficiency.

The QNG (Qualitätssiegel Nachhaltiges Gebäude) is a German state seal of quality for sustainable buildings. It is required to unlock the highest KfW subsidy levels (up to 150,000 € subsidized loan).

The calculator compares the total financial outflow (interest payments + upgrade costs) of EH40 and EH40+PV scenarios against the EH55 baseline. It factors in interest savings from subsidies and reduced energy costs over 25 years.

Detailed Methodology & Calculation Logic

Financing Logic

The calculator compares different mortgage setups with varying loan amounts and interest rates (reflecting KfW subsidies).

  • Interest Differential: Calculates the total interest paid for each scenario over a 10-year period.
  • Baseline Comparison: All benefits are calculated relative to the EH55 baseline scenario.
Profitability & ROI

We perform a 25-year lifecycle analysis to identify when higher energy standards pay off.

  • Energy Savings: Includes annual savings from reduced thermal demand and PV yield.
  • Net Profit: Calculated as (Interest Saved + Energy Yield) - Upfront Upgrade Costs relative to EH55.
